Optimal inclination angle for solar photovoltaic power generation
According to GB 50797-2012's “Photovoltaic Power Station Design Standard,” optimal tilt is defined as the angle at which a fixed PV array at this tilt angle maximizes annual total radiation. If its yearly radiation increases at that angle, that angle would be considered optimal. Among hundreds of research work performed pertinent to solar PV panels performance, this work critically reviews the role of tilt angles and particularly locating the optimum. . To determine the optimal solar tilt angle for photovoltaic panels, one must consider geographic location, seasonal changes, and household energy needs, with a common approach being to set the angle equal to the latitude for year-round efficiency.
